    Jackson student wins 2024 Amazon Future Engineer Scholarship

    By Kaitlin Howell,

    30 days ago

    JACKSON, Miss. ( WJTV ) – A Forest Hill High School senior received a $40,000 scholarship towards the college/university of her choice.

    According to the Jackson Public School District (JPS), Kiesa Currie-Kimball aims to pursue a career in software programming and cybersecurity. She received the funds from the 2024 Amazon Future Engineer Scholarship.

    Currie-Kimball was one of two students selected from Mississippi. She will receive up to $40,000 in tuition to attend the college of her choice and a paid internship offer at Amazon after her first year of college.

    “Yes, this was it, and when I found out, it was a surprise,” Currie-Kimball stated. “I was really excited!”

    She is now trying to decide where she will spend the next four years – University of Mississippi or Mississippi State.
